NSW half Mitchell Moses was all business when he spoke to Paul Gallen. Asked what the Blues needed to do tonight, the Eels No 7 responded: “Kick well, finish our sets, get them coming off our line and take it to them. They’re not happy with the way they performed game two so they’ll come out fired up, so are we.”

Queensland veteran Ben Hunt had a word with Johnathan Thurston on the team bus on the way into the stadium.

“Mate, it’s going to be a fast, physical game. They’re going to come out similar to what they did in Melbourne. We need to match that. I think it’s going to be won in the middle, through the trenches with the big boys. That’s going to start in the first 20 minutes.”

NSW XVII

Michael Maguire has been forced into making just one change to his run-on side for the decider with Bradman Best replacing the injured Latrell Mitchell in the centres. Madge has also tweaked his bench with Mitchell Barnett set to make his Origin debut, with Haumole Olakau’atu missing out.
